Lilies on the Land

Royal and Derngate Theatre 19-21 Guildhall Road,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N1 1DP

Lilies on the Land is an extraordinary piece of theatre telling the story of Britain’s Women’s Land Army of World War II. Based on hundreds of actual letters with Original Land Girls, the play focuses on four very different women who all come together during Britain’s darkest hour determined to “do their bit” for King and Country. Working long hours, in clothes full of mice, the bonds formed during the war would last a lifetime as women’s stories unfold. Not only do they have to learn the ways of working on the land the hard way, but they have to deal with being far from home and their loved ones, as outsiders in unfamiliar circumstances. At times hilarious, at times heartbreaking, this story of some of the country’s unsung heroes is a wonderfully rich piece of theatre.

Markus Birdman: Platinum

Royal and Derngate Theatre 19-21 Guildhall Road,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N1 1DP

Phil McIntyre Live proudly presents Markus Birdman: Platinum – Star of Britain’s Got Talent 2023 June 5th 2021, I had a stroke. It was my second. I found myself in hospital, mid lockdown, with no visitors allowed. I’ve permanently lost half my eyesight. One night I went to the toilet and sat down on another naked blind man, already there. I was too blind to see him. He was too blind to stop me! So it’s not ALL doom! I’d like to tell you about it. Not to create feelings of pity toward me, more a sense of awe & fawning admiration. I have had a unique experience about a topic, often sniggered over, but I’m keen to make you laugh, but also to raise a little awareness. Well done me! (Ahem!) Markus Birdman has thundered back into comedy with his Edinburgh Fringe show earning him a nomination for the 2023 Chortle Awards. He has also recently written for Jayde Adams and supported Jason Manford at the Palladium.

Christmas pudding workshop with Carmela Sereno-Hayes

Northampton Museum And Art Gallery 4-6 Guildhall Rd,, Northampton, Northamptonshire, United Kingdom

Saturday 18 November 10am - 1pm £30 including all materials Join us once again for this festive cookery class. Carmela will begin by showcasing a wonderful seasonal tiramisu, clementine and pear. Then a super quick batch of cannoli shells filled with ricotta, icing sugar and mixed peel. One variety will be dipped in chopped nuts and the other in chocolate. Carmela will finish by demonstrating to you all, some delicious Italian jam filled cookies that you will make and bake at home. She will also show you how to make her signature amaretto and cranberry Christmas pudding, you will all make this plump fruity pudding to take home and steam. All ingredients supplied. You will be advised on booking of all equipment you need to bring with you. Booking essential.

Wonka Family Fun Day

town centre

‘Win Your Christmas’ by taking part in this year’s Golden Ticket giveaway – to be launched by Willy Wonka at a family fun day! The Wonka-themed event will be held from 11am to 4pm on Saturday, 18th November in Grosvenor Shopping Northampton and will feature character walkabouts, stilt walkers, hula hoopers, balloon modelling and face painting. The ever-popular Golden Ticket giveaway will see four lucky winners each win £500 as part of the £2,000 prize fund, simply by hand-posting an entry ticket into special BID post boxes found in 10 town centre locations from Saturday, 18th November onwards. Tickets are available from retailers around the town throughout the festive period.
